Mission Control SF
CoFounder, Bridge Member
December 2000 to Present
Mission Control is a sex-positive, volunteer-based and member-supported community center located in the heart of San Francisco that hosts events and gatherings that inspire artistic, sensual, and social evolution. As of January 2010, Mission Control became a membership supported community organization governed by an elected board and run by a dedicated volunteer crew. Mission Control is home to Kinky Salon, Club Kiss and Pink and continues to be home for a variety of creative, open hearted, and sex positive events.

The Moral Minority is a production company that specializes in creating outrageous, colorful, interactive, events which immerse guests in living, breathing, themed environments. Founders Polly Whittaker and Barron Scott Levkoff have racked up 10 years of experience producing spectacular events together, and even more individually before they began working together in 2000. The Moral Minority brings together a unique fusion of improv performance, narrative, design, and interactivity to create worlds which surprise and inspire. Consultant: Couchsurfing
2004
http://couchsurfing.org
Consulted Casey Fenton, owner and developer of Couchsurfing.com, on expanding his Vision and Mission Statement when his site had only several hundred people on it. Specifically, helped to broaden the couch surfing experience from one of just ‘finding a couch to crash on’ to an angle of ‘cultural experience sharing and hosting’.
Past Moral Minority events include:
The Exotic Erotic Ball VIP Lounge 2004, 2005, 2006, 2007, 2008, 2009, 2010
For the last 6 years i coproduced this annual party within a party, growing it from a small corner of the event with 150 attendees, to an enormous spectacle in 16,000 square feet, with 1500 attendees, and 5 stages of ongoing performance, transforming a cavernous venue into a 360° immersive spectacle. We were responsible for every aspect of the production including sound, lighting, staging, décor and performance.
